无法调试基于.NET的PowerPoint加载项

时间:2014-05-08 13:14:54

标签: visual-studio-2013

我有一个使用.NET Framework 4.0 / C#/ VSTO开发的PowerPoint加载项。 当我手动启动PowerPoint时,加载项加载正常,但是当我在Visual Studio中按F5时,PowerPoint启动画面会显示一段时间,然后PowerPoint关闭。 Visual Studio输出窗口仅显示以下行:

'powerpnt.exe'(CLR v4.0.30319:DefaultDomain):已加载'C:\ Windows \ Microsoft.Net \ assembly \ GAC_32 \ mscorlib \ v4.0_4.0.0.0__b77a5c561934e089 \ mscorlib.dll'。跳过加载符号。模块已经过优化,调试器选项“Just My Code”已启用。 程序'[6016] powerpnt.exe:Program Trace'已退出代码0(0x0)。 程序'[6016] powerpnt.exe'已退出,代码为-2146233082(0x80131506)。

我尝试了以下内容:

  • 硬盘扫描
  • 重新安装VSTO

您有其他建议可以解决此问题吗?

1 个答案:

答案 0 :(得分:1)

我已经卸载了EMET 4.1,并且在重新启动系统后,我已经能够再次调试。现在我无法确定EMET是罪魁祸首,因为我之前已经安装了EMET进行调试。我会尽可能安装EMET。